Global Commercial & Industrial Adsorption Technology Trends

In modern industrial process engineering, gas and liquid dehydration stands as a vital cornerstone. Molecular sieve dryers utilize synthetic aluminosilicates (zeolites) characterized by precisely defined, uniform pore structures to isolate moisture down to the parts-per-billion (ppb) level.

Transition to Ultra-Low Dew Point Operation

Global demand is rapidly shifting towards extreme dew points (-40°C to -70°C Pressure Dew Point, or PDP) to support cleanroom automation, microelectronics manufacturing, and clean-energy infrastructure. Dryers that once relied purely on silica gel are transitioning to multi-layered molecular sieve beds, providing superior adsorption capacities under high-temperature fluctuations.

Energy Recovery and Thermal Swing Optimization

Energy efficiency is now a major parameter in purchasing calculations. Plant operators are actively adopting Heat-of-Compression (HOC) and Zero-Purge desiccant dryer configurations. Integrating advanced molecular sieves with high thermal stability minimizes regeneration heat requirements, translating directly to reduced carbon emissions and lowered operational expenditure (OPEX).

Global Enterprise Procurement Requirements & TCO Analysis

For procurement managers and engineering consulting firms, buying adsorbents for desiccant air dryers involves far more than comparing price lists. Calculating Total Cost of Ownership (TCO) requires analyzing several performance metrics:

Crushing Strength & Attrition Rate

Low mechanical strength leads to rapid particulate dusting under cyclic pressure fluctuations. Selecting materials with a low attrition rate prevents filter clogging and downstream pipe contamination, avoiding costly early replacement cycles.

Dynamic Water Adsorption Capacity

Determines how long a molecular sieve bed can sustain target dew points before requiring regeneration heat. High adsorption capacity translates directly into longer cycle times and lower energy usage.

Hydrothermal Stability

During the thermal regeneration cycles of TSA dryers (often reaching 200°C to 300°C), zeolite structures face structural stress. Excellent hydrothermal stability ensures the material maintains its crystalline lattice over thousands of heating cycles.

Targeted Solutions Across Diverse Demands

Molecular sieve dryers serve critical functions across several core industries, each requiring specific configurations to operate efficiently:

Air Separation Units (ASU)

Prior to cryogenic distillation, atmospheric air must be thoroughly stripped of carbon dioxide (CO2) and trace moisture. Multi-bed adsorption systems filled with 13X Molecular Sieves prevent carbon dioxide ice blockages inside cold boxes.

Petrochemical & Natural Gas Processing

LNG liquefaction demands deep moisture extraction to sub-ppm levels (dew point -100°C) to prevent gas hydrates from crystallizing. Our 3A and 4A Molecular Sieves are optimized for selective moisture removal, without co-adsorbing hydrocarbons like methane or ethane.

Automotive Air Brake Systems

In heavy duty freight logistics, moisture freezing inside brake line pneumatic valves represents a critical safety risk. High-capacity molecular sieve cartridges continuously capture moisture, ensuring smooth braking action in sub-zero winter temperatures.

Industrial Adsorption Q&A: Technical Insights

Find technical explanations regarding product choice, operational optimization, and molecular sieve dryer maintenance:

What is the difference between molecular sieves and silica gel in industrial air dryers?
Molecular sieves feature uniform pore structures (like 3Å, 4Å, 5Å, or 10Å) that selectively capture water molecules based on size exclusion while excluding larger compounds. They maintain strong moisture adsorption capacity even at high temperatures (up to 150°C) and low relative humidity, enabling dew points of -70°C. In contrast, silica gel is an amorphous silica with variable pore distribution, primarily operating through capillary condensation. It is best suited for high moisture levels, but loses adsorption capacity as temperature rises.
How do you calculate the regeneration energy required for a molecular sieve dryer bed?
Total heat load is calculated by summing three values: the sensible heat required to warm the steel vessel and the internal molecular sieve bed from feed temperature to target regeneration temperature (typically 200°C to 280°C), the heat of desorption needed to break the chemical bond between the zeolite lattice and water molecules (approx. 3200-3500 kJ/kg of adsorbed water), and heat loss to the surroundings through the vessel walls.
What causes molecular sieve degradation, and how can it be mitigated?
Degradation is typically caused by hydrothermal aging (repeated heating in the presence of liquid water), blockages from oil mist carryover from upstream air compressors, and acidic chemical attack. To mitigate these risks, install high-efficiency coalescing pre-filters to capture oil aerosols, incorporate a sacrificial bed of activated alumina (like JZ-K1) at the inlet to protect the zeolite from liquid water, and ensure regeneration heating rates are properly controlled.
How does JB/T 10532-2017 impact compressed air system design?
JB/T 10532-2017 establishes standard parameters for adsorption compressed air dryers, specifying mandatory pressure drop safety limits, nominal dew points, structural integrity tests, and energy consumption standards. Adhering to this standard ensures components are engineered to withstand continuous cycle swings and maintain stable pressure dew points during shifting system loads.
